-
525439JP
Trans Electro Valve
-
277790JP
Trans Oil Pressure Sensor
-
124240JP
Trans Temperature Sender
-
519187JP
Alternator
-
442996JP
Crankshaft
-
962228JP
Diff Lock Switch
-
257789JP
Door Handle inc Key
-
766922JP
Draft Link Bumper
-
302261JP
Gasket
-
668248JP
Gasket
-
856291JP
Hose
-
571080JP
Hub Seal
-
688668JP
Inlet Valve
-
644987JP
Inner Axle Seal